SpringSimulation 用来构建弹簧,SpringDescription 用来配置弹簧的属性
//弹簧的属性配置
SpringDescription(
mass: 10,//质量
stiffness: 1000,//硬度
damping: 0.75,//阻尼系数
),
SpringSimulation mass 属性 弹簧的质量
mass 弹簧的质量,越小就越轻,弹性越强,越大越笨重,弹性越小
质量为10的效果
质量为 1 的效果
质量为 100 的效果
SpringSimulation stiffness 属性 弹簧的硬度
stiffness 硬度为1
SpringDescription(
mass: 10,//质量
stiffness: 10,//硬度
damping: 0.75,//阻尼系数
),
stiffness 硬度为10
stiffness 硬度为1000
SpringSimulation damping 属性 弹簧的阻尼系数
阻尼系数 越大,弹性越小。
阻尼系数 damping 取值为0.05时
//弹簧的属性配置
SpringDescription(
mass: 10,//质量
stiffness: 1000,//硬度
damping: 0.05,//阻尼系数
)
damping 取值为0.75时
完毕